Google has implemented artificial intelligence (AI) functionalities from its Gemini model into the Waze navigation application. This integration, reported on July 13, 2026, is part of a broader corporate strategy by Google to consolidate Gemini across its ecosystem of products and services. The initiative aims to enhance user experience personalization and optimize interaction within the navigation platform.
The updates announced by Waze include four new functionalities. It is noteworthy that, according to reports, only two of these features are directly attributed to Gemini AI technology. The other improvements focus on updating Waze's conversational repository, indicating a generalized effort to optimize voice interaction and route personalization.

Historically, navigation applications have evolved from simple mapping and direction systems to platforms incorporating real-time traffic data, incident alerts, and route personalization. The addition of generative and conversational AI, such as that provided by Gemini, represents the next step in this evolution. It allows for a more fluid and natural interaction with the application, as well as dynamic adaptation of the navigation experience to individual driver preferences. This includes, for example, the ability to refine voice commands for more specific information or to adjust the 'personality' of the voice guide.
The introduction of Gemini AI-powered features in Waze has direct economic implications in the highly competitive navigation app market. Waze, acquired by Google in 2013, actively competes with services like Apple Maps, which has also invested in improving its mapping and navigation capabilities. Differentiation through advanced AI can be a decisive factor for user retention and acquisition.
From an economic perspective, enhancing the user experience through AI can translate into increased application usage time and greater platform loyalty. For Google, this means an increase in the collection of traffic and user behavior data, valuable assets for monetization through localized advertising and continuous improvement of its algorithms. A more active and satisfied user base strengthens Waze's market position and, by extension, Google's in the mobility services segment.
Advanced route personalization and efficient voice interaction can reduce user friction, making the application more attractive than rivals lacking comparable AI functionalities. This could influence long-term market share, forcing competitors to accelerate their own AI integration initiatives to maintain relevance.
